SECOND SYMPHONY CONCERT

WILL BE GIVEN IN SANDERS THEATRE THIS EVENING AT 8.--THE PROGRAM.

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The Boston Symphony Orchestra Will give the second of a series of eight concerts under the direction of Max Friedler in Sanders Theatre this evening at $ o'clock. Miss Lilla Ormond will be the soloist. Tickets at $1 each are now on sale at Kent's University Bookstore.

The program will be as follows: Cherubini, Overture to the Opera "Lodoiska"; Brahms, Symphony in E minor, No. 4, op. 98; Aria; Debussy, Prelude to "The Afternoon of a Faun"; Aria; Gilbert, Comedy Overture on Negro Themes.

The other concerts will be given on the following. Thursday evenings: December 14, January 18, February 8, February 29, March 28, and April 25.
